Ibn Abi Usaibia Life story
Ibn Abī Uṣaybiʿa Muʾaffaq al-Dīn Abū al-ʿAbbās Aḥmad Ibn Al-Qāsim Ibn Khalīfa al-Khazrajī, commonly referred to as Ibn Abi Usaibia, was an Arab physician from Syria in the 13th century CE.
